Abstract
The influence of added [60]fullerene on the gelation ability of Zn(II) porphyrin appended cholestrol derivatives was discussed. A highly ordered aggregation mode was induced by the intermolecular Zn(II) porphyrin-[60]fullerene interaction that forced porphyrin moieties to form regular sandwich complexes with [60]fullerene. The analysis showed that the slight structural charge in gelators was multiplicatively reflected by the higher order structure of the organogel fibers.
